Неправильный импорт WebStorm с реагировать-родной-веб? - PullRequest
0 голосов
/ 16 апреля 2020

Пытаясь работать с собственным приложением реагирования, я использую Webstorm 2019.3.4 с простым пустым проектом приложения реагирования, созданным с помощью expo init myProject

Всякий раз, когда я использую нативные компоненты реакции, такие как <Text>, WebStorm предлагает функцию автоматического импорта

Однако компонент импортирован из неправильной библиотеки. Он вытягивает его из react-native-web вместо react-native

Вот пакет по умолчанию. json:

 "dependencies": {
   "react-native": "https://github.com/expo/react-native/archive/sdk-37.0.1.tar.gz",
   "react-native-web": "~0.11.7"
   ...

Как здесь работает автоматический импорт? Как я могу переключиться на импорт по реакции?

Спасибо

1 Ответ

0 голосов
/ 17 апреля 2020

В качестве обходного пути, пожалуйста, добавьте react-native-web/**/* в Не импортировать точно из ... списка в Настройки | Редактор | Код Стиль | JavaScript - Импорт . Для завершения кода с автоматическим импортом для собственных компонентов React Native, пожалуйста, проголосуйте за эту проблему и следите за обновлениями: WEB-35144

...